Occupation
Financial controller
Financial controllers run the accounting function: the close timetable, the reporting that comes out of it, the controls around it, and the team doing the work. The role is accountable for whether reported numbers are right, which makes it as much about process and people as about accounting technique.

What the work involves
- Own the monthly, quarterly, and annual close timetable and keep it on track.
- Review reconciliations, journals, and schedules prepared by the finance team.
- Produce statutory and management reporting packs and their supporting analysis.
- Maintain accounting policies and the internal controls that protect the records.
- Coordinate external audit and respond to findings and recommendations.
- Plan team resourcing, systems changes, and process improvements in finance.
How people commonly enter
- A professional accounting qualification following an accounting, finance, or business degree.
- Progression from financial accountant, management accountant, or audit roles.
- A postgraduate finance or business degree combined with accounting experience.
- A move from external audit into an in-house senior accounting role.
